Thanks to some very generous individuals and organisations, the Community Recovery Hub located at the Balmoral Village Hall is inviting you to apply for bushfire recovery assistance funding.


WHAT IS BEING OFFERED? Gift cards to the maximum value of $200 per family/household will be available to eligible applicants in accordance with the constitution of our Recovery Assistance Fund. Gifts cards will be distributed to help meet expenses of bushfire affected families who have lost their primary place of residence, including homes that are uninhabitable, in the Wingecarribee and Wollondilly local government areas.

The purpose of the Recovery Assistance Fund 2019/20 is to provide relief for households of the Wingecarribee and Wollondilly Local government Areas who have lost their primary place of residence due to the bushfire event of 2019/20. Additional funding rounds may occur following closure of round one applications.

TO APPLY - Check the eligibility criteria, complete the application form and return it with proof of identity. Applications for this round are open until 30 April 2020.

Your application will be reviewed and assessed by the Community Recovery Hub Assistance Fund Committee and you will be notified of the outcome.
